Start/Pause
Press Start to begin the cycle.
Pressing Pause will unlock the lid (if locked at that time), pause the cycle and the Pause indicator light will blink.
To continue the cycle, press Start again. If machine is paused more than 12 hours, the cycle will be cancelled. If water remains in the
machine, select the Drain & Spin cycle to drain basket and spin water out of the washer basket.
Cycle Status Lights
Shows whether the washer is in the Fill, Soak, Wash, Rinse or Spin portion of the cycle.
If an out-of-balance condition is detected by the washer, the Spin light will blink during the remaining portion of the cycle and will
stay illuminated for a short time after cycle completion. When this occurs, the washer is taking actions to correct the out-of-balance
condition and complete the cycle normally. In some cases, the washer may not be able to balance the load and spin up to full
speed. If you notice the load is more wet than normal at the end of the cycle, redistribute the load evenly in the wash basket and
run a Drain & Spin cycle.
